Transaction f4e99fc40af92b846b059ea56438fb9bc3385453a1d15531b4bcf9adeeb46e0e

1 Input
2 Outputs
  • f4e99fc40af92b846b059ea56438fb9bc3385453a1d15531b4bcf9adeeb46e0e:0
  • value  23886261
    address  37cYYK6RGPCM6KdUPBid3wEdqmZizxr56f
  • f4e99fc40af92b846b059ea56438fb9bc3385453a1d15531b4bcf9adeeb46e0e:1
  • value  227489208
    address  17v8BysTmrWMxf8d4ierKgt91x3Y5F2TUv